Red Wing Chevrolet Buick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Red Wing Chevrolet Buick in the United States is $94,299.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$45. Salaries at Red Wing Chevrolet Buick typically range from $82,902 to $106,697 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

Red Wing Chevrolet Buick Overview

Website
www.redwingchev.net
Founded In
1929
Employees
25 - 50 employees
Industry
Retail & Wholesale
Headquarter Address
2500 Hwy 61 W Red Wing Minnesota MN 55066
Revenue
$10 Million - $50 Million
Phone Number
+1 6514170450

What Is the Cost of Living Near Minneap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Minneap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Red Wing Chevrolet Buick.
Minneap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 7.9% more than MN average). Major city, vibrant, housing costs above US avg, cold winters (high heating). Metro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Red Wing Chevrolet Buick,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of Red Wing Chevrolet Buick sal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$230 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$120 (Metro Transit mon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,920 - $4,480+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
